?Measles virus Measles virus Virus classification Group: Group V ((-)ssRNA) Order: Mononegavirales Family: Paramyxoviridae Genus: Morbillivirus Species: Measles virus Measles, also known as rubeola, is a disease caused by a virus of the genus Morbillivirus. Reports of measles go back to at least 600 BCE, however, the first scientific description of the disease and its distinction from smallpox is attributed to the Persian physician Ibn Razi (Rhazes) 860-932 who pub ...
